If you wash belts or coins, the door glass might break

Removing belts from your trousers and jeans is HIGHLY mandatory. Even if the glass of the washing machine doors is toughened, a belt buckle spinning at no less than 1,600 rpm would undoubtedly break the glass in the door in an instant.

Even more, something very small such as a coin might end up blocking the filter or even causing a din when your machine spins. Once you’ve removed the belts from the laundry, you should also consider using a laundry bag for any of your clothes that have large metal buttons.

Plus, lowering the spin might help mitigate the already low risk of glass breaking.
